Transaction 7908d52628be0188acfdbd7363cc2e175f6e937dade26a45ccb3d0dd37875b72
1 Input
1 Output
-
7908d52628be0188acfdbd7363cc2e175f6e937dade26a45ccb3d0dd37875b72:0
- value
- 95440212
- script pubkey
- OP_0 OP_PUSHBYTES_20 df7cb7cd56ce8a36baa6fd219cdd7f1f8aa7a80c
- address
- bc1qma7t0n2ke69rdw4xl5seehtlr79202qvxw4fk4